Volaris Group Expands Insurance Portfolio with Acquisition of SSP Limited

Volaris Group Inc. (“Volaris”) today announced the successful completion of the purchase of SSP Limited (“SSP”), which is the seventh acquisition in the Insurance and Benefits Administration vertical.

SSP is a leading global supplier of technology systems and software for the property and casualty insurance industry. Founded in 1984, SSP strives to supporting its global customer base, while keeping a clear focus on innovation. The company’s software solutions are designed to help insurers and brokers operate their businesses more efficiently.

In line with Volaris’ philosophy of acquiring, strengthening and growing mission-critical software companies, SSP maintains its independence. Volaris will provide support, coaching and new best practices to SSP, while the company continues to operate autonomously.


About Volaris Group
Volaris acquires, strengthens and grows vertical market technology companies. As an Operating Group of Constellation Software Inc., Volaris is all about strengthening businesses within the markets they compete and enabling them to grow – whether that growth comes through organic measures such as new initiatives and product development, day-to-day business, or through complementary acquisitions.
